cycling: Jaroslav Kulhavy is missing in Pietermaritzburg

April 7, 2014 by the editorial office

kulhavy

Jaroslav Kulhavy will not be able to start at the World Cup opener in Pietermaritzburg next weekend. The Olympic champion injured his knee earlier this year [Link] however, managed to build up his form in time, as he proved with a solid race in Langenlois last weekend. But now, shortly before the first big race of the season, the fast Czech falls ill and is currently in bed with a fever of 38,7 degrees.
